SPECIFICATIONS
physical_formLIQUID
distillation_temp78.5 DEG CELSIUS MINIMUM INITIAL BOILING POINT AND 81.0 DEG CELSIUS MAXIMUM DRY
specific_gravity_value0.805 MINIMUM AND 0.807 MAXIMUM
special_handling_featureFLAMMABLE
composition_and_percentage99.0 MINIMUM BY WEIGHT METHYL ETHYL KETONE
nondefinitive_spec/std_dataI TYPE
medical_designation_and_gradeTECHNICAL
impurities_limitation_in_percentALCOHOL/AS SECONDARY BUTYLALCOHOL/0.7
quantity_within_each_unit_package5.000 GALLONS
substance/water_temp_at_specific_gravity_ratio20.0 DEG CELSIUS
NSN6810-00-281-2762
